What is ISO 27001 and Why Does Your Organization Need It?

ISO 27001 is the leading international standard for Information Security Management Systems (ISMS). It is designed to help organizations protect sensitive information through effective risk management. Achieving ISO 27001 certification shows that your organization has implemented structured, systematic, and secure information-handling practices.

The importance of  ISO 27001 Compliance:

Build customer and stakeholder confidence

Avoid data breaches  and reduce security risks

Meet international regulation benchmarks (GDPR, HIPAA, etc.)

Improve the effectiveness and robustness of internal security processes.

How FileAgo Simplifies Your Journey to ISO 27001

FileAgo is designed to equip organizations with strong tools that fit seamlessly with ISO 27001 standards. FileAgo provides an all-in-one solution for data access control, incident management, and recovery to help organizations develop a secure and compliant environment.

Unique Permission Controls and Data Security by Design

The main idea of ISO 27001 is the principle of limited access to sensitive information - a need that FileAgo meets using its unique and patented combination of waterfall and granular permissions. You can give precise access controls to your data for internal teams or external collaborators.

You can also control the access rights, from a read-only view, through watermarking, one-time view or download link, expiry date and time and domain restrictions. These controls assist in the compliance of Information Security Policies and Access Control (Annex A.5 and A.9).

 FileAgo also offers AES-256 military grade encryption for data in transit and at rest,  and this is fully aligned with Cryptography (Annex A.10).

Digital Rights Management  (DRM) features make sure that the data is still under control when it is shared.

Comprehensive Audit and Monitoring

 FileAgo’s comprehensive audit logs with more than 50+ action types, real-time alerts, and notifications provide organizations with full visibility and traceability of user activity in terms of access, collaboration within and outside the organization, downloading, and permission changes. This enables the organization to support Operations Security and Incident Management (Annex  A.12 and A.16) to help organizations detect, report, and respond to security incidents quickly.

Data Recovery, Versioning, and Loss Prevention

With FileAgo’s Data Leak and Loss Prevention (DLP) mechanisms and the ability to perform automated data versioning and disaster recovery, no files are ever lost and can always be restored to their previous version. FileAgo blocks permanent deletion and thus provides full data recovery assurance, thus supporting  Business Continuity and Data Recovery (BCDR) (Annex A.17).

Controlled Collaboration and Data Sharing

For safe external collaboration, FileAgo enables one-time view/download links, expiry controls, read only access with watermarks and email domain restrictions so that the data is shared in the right manner and with the right people — as per the recommendations of Communications Security and Supplier Relationships (Annex  A.13 and A.15). 

Furthermore, device management ensures that the use of FileAgo is restricted to authorized devices only, thus complying with Access Control and Operational Security (Annex A.9 and  A.12).

Data Organization, Tagging, and Team-Based Workspaces

 FileAgo offers group and personal workspaces to keep the data segregation appropriate, so that inappropriate groups or persons should not be able to get access to the sensitive files (Annex A.6  and A.7). The information can be also sorted and classified by using tags and comments, which will help with the Asset Management and Information Classification (Annex A.8).

Operational Security, Resource Control, and Duplication Prevention

To increase the efficiency of operations and optimization of storage space, FileAgo provides quota setting for users and teams, deduplication to remove redundant data and only store the incremental chunks of data, and  Web/Network Drive that enables direct access and sync of files from webdrive. These controls are consistent with the requirements of Operations Security (Annex A.12) to secure and manage information properly.

Authentication, Data Syncing, and Device Management

FileAgo implements Two Factor Authentication (2FA) to authenticate users, as required by  Access Control (Annex A.9). FileAgo also provides device management to regulate and limit access to only permitted devices.

As of now, FileAgo supports secure access and sync from  WebDrive and is set to further improve the data availability and redundancy.

Communication and Collaboration Tools

FileAgo’s chat functionality enables secure internal communication, supporting Information Transfer policies (Annex A.13) to keep discussions and data sharing within a controlled environment, reducing reliance on unsecured communication channels.
